Melissa Bailey, MD

Dr. Melissa Bailey completed her obstetrics and gynecology residency at Georgia Baptist Medical Center, in Atlanta, Georgia, where she served as chief resident in her fourth year. Upon graduation, she received the J. Marion Sims award for excellence in gynecologic surgery. Dr. Bailey was awarded her doctor of medicine degree from the University Of Texas Medical Branch at Galveston, Texas. As a medical student, she performed research on life developmental delays suffered by low birth weight and premature birth.

Dr. Bailey completed her undergraduate studies at the University Of Texas, at Austin, with a Bachelor Of Arts Degree in Biology and a minor in Chemistry. She is a graduate of Lewisville High School and is a current resident of Frisco, Texas with her husband, John, also a physician, and her two children, Wesley and Sarah. After having a private practice in Atlanta, Georgia for five years, Dr. Bailey recently moved back to the North Dallas area. She and her husband enjoy being close to family and friends and raising their children in our fabulous community. Joining her best friend, Dr. Leslie Welborne, in practice, has been a life long dream. Together, they look forward to providing compassionate, comprehensive, and state of the art medical care to the women in this community.

Leslie S. Welborne, MD

Dr. Leslie S. Welborne, who is originally from the metroplex, was happy to return to the North Dallas area, after completing her residency at the University of Missouri in Kansas City. She was awarded her doctor of medicine degree at the University of Texas Medical Branch in Galveston, Texas, where she met her best friend and partner, Dr Melissa Bailey. Dr. Welborne received her undergraduate degree in chemical engineering, from the University of Arizona, after graduating from J. J. Pearce High School, in Richardson, Texas.

Although Dr. Welborne has been practicing in the Collin County area since 1999, she was so excited to have the opportunity to become a member of the Frisco healthcare community, in 2004. She lives in Frisco with her husband, Patrick and sons Brittan and Kieran. She is happy to be serving this great community. Her goal is to promote a friendly and caring environment, while offering the women of our community a full range of obstetrics and gynecology.

Arden Moulin, NP, RN, WHNP

Arden Moulin is a native-born Texan. She has lived in the greater North Texas area most of her life. She graduated from Plano Senior High School. In high school Arden started working at Medical City Dallas as a Physical Therapy tech and has been working in healthcare ever since. She received her registered nurse (RN) degree in 1987. As an RN she worked in the maternal child areas for 7 years. Those areas included Pediatrics, Pediatric ICU and Neonatal ICU. In 1995 she received her Women’s Healthcare Nurse Practitioners Certification degree from UT Southwestern Medical School.

Since graduating Arden has served on the North Texas March of Dimes Grant Committee for 2 years, has been an Implanon instructor, and a Nurse Practitioner clinical preceptor for Women’s Healthcare & Family Practice students. She has practiced in offices located in HEB, Grapevine and Flower Mound.

Arden’s areas of interest include gynecology, obstetrics, urogynecology, osteoporosis prevention & intervention, perimenopause, and menopause. She is BioTE trained and has a good understanding of the healthcare challenges in midlife. Along with caring for women Arden enjoys working with adolescents because of her background in pediatric care. In the past 20 plus years as a Nurse Practitioner she has cared for patients from 10 to 95 years of age. Arden believes that women need to participate in their evidence-based health care options and choices.
